Performance and Hardware

The iPad Pro M2 is powered by Apple’s M2 chip, delivering exceptional performance for demanding creative applications, multitasking, and professional workflows. It features up to 16GB of RAM and fast storage options. The Google Pixel Slate is equipped with Intel processors, which are capable but generally less optimized for high-end creative tasks. It offers up to 16GB of RAM and various storage configurations, suitable for general productivity but less so for intensive creative work.

Display and Creative Capabilities

The iPad Pro M2 features a stunning 12.9-inch or 11-inch Liquid Retina display with ProMotion technology, supporting a 120Hz refresh rate that enhances drawing, scrolling, and video editing. The Apple Pencil (second generation) offers precise input for artists and designers. The Google Pixel Slate has a 12.3-inch display with a 3000×2000 resolution, but it lacks the high refresh rate and advanced stylus support found in the iPad Pro. For creative professionals, the iPad Pro’s display and stylus ecosystem are superior.
